Gross monthly income works out to about $5,629,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,689/mo in rent. Portsmouth's median rent of $2,920 exceeds that threshold by $1,231/mo, putting a real estate agent salary into the rent-burdened range here. A real estate agent works roughly 89.9 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and a real estate agent salary

Real estate agent pay is commission-driven and varies widely with local market conditions. The BLS mean averages high and low producers. At the national-average agent salary, the 30% rule supports about $1,640 a month in rent — though successful agents in active markets earn well above this.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ived New Hampshire state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Portsmouth, NH.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
